Sarah Marie Hann, 74, of Indianapolis, Indiana, passed away on January 18, 2024. She was born on May 12, 1949, in Muncie, Indiana, to parents, Cecil Alvin Tinkle and Carol Elizabeth (Mitchell) Tinkle.   

On March 8, 1975, in Indianapolis, Indiana, Sarah married the love of her life, Jeff Hann, spending a loving and cherished 48 years together.  

Sarah possessed a quirky sense of humor that she shared with her children and grandchildren. She had an extraordinary ability to bring joy and laughter to any situation. Her humor was a gift that she graciously bestowed upon her family, brightening their lives with every witty remark, slight of sarcasm or playful joke. 

Her role as a wife, mother and grandmother was one that she cherished above all else. Sarah's dedication to her family knew no bounds. No matter the circumstance or challenge that life presented, she consistently exhibited kindness, patience, and generosity towards everyone around her. Her unwavering love for her family was evident in every daily interaction and milestone celebrated together. 

Once a year, Sarah and her husband Jeff looked forward to their yearly trips to different areas in Tennessee. It was during these trips that they would immerse themselves in the vibrant sounds of country, western, and gospel shows. 

Apart from music travels, Sarah also found solace in the pages of books. Reading was more than just a hobby for her; it was a passion that fueled her imagination and enriched her understanding of the world. 

Sarah's passing leaves an indescribable void in the lives of those closest to her. Yet amidst the sorrow lies gratitude for having shared precious moments with such an extraordinary woman. The memory of Sarah will forever be engraved in their hearts. 

Sarah is survived by her loving husband, Jeffrey Carl Hann; children, Rachel L. Hann, William L.C. “Andy” Smith, and Kathryn “Katie” E. Hann; sister, Betty Ann Donnelly; and 5 grandchildren. 

She was preceded in death by her parents, Cecil and Carol Tinkle.
